At the Nikah ceremony, the couple takes their vows and signs the marriage certificate that validates their union. A typical Muslim wedding consists of two major parts, the Nikah ceremony, which takes up to thirty minutes, and the Walima, roughly three to four hours. However, if the event is followed by a reception, it could be two to three hours.
